About Prosser Family

Prosser Family Campground is located on the picturesque Prosser Reservoir within the Tahoe National Forest, 10 minutes north of Truckee. Visitors enjoy the area for its many recreational opportunities such as boating, canoeing, paddling, fishing, and abundant hiking, biking, and off-road trails. This facility is operated and maintained by Lake Tahoe Hospitality LLC for the Tahoe National Forest.

This was a great place to dry camp. There were quite a few spots that our 39' motorhome fit, but there were many tent campers enjoying the campground as well. And if you are in a tent, the vault toilets were clean. So many biking and hiking trails in the area kept us busy for several days. The only reason for 4 stars is that the water was turned off. Apparently, according to the camp host, there is some malfunction at the source and there has been no water for several months. Not a problem for us as we arrived with a full fresh water tank, but we encountered many people who were caught unprepared by the water spigots not working.
